As for the easiest Wonderboy to get into? Hard to to say honestly.

Easiest pick up and play is Wonderboy. That game is more like a side scroller though. Was released in arcades.. its pretty much Adventure Island only the original version. That said though your missing out on the MetroidVania style game play.

Wonderboy In Monster Land is more like The Legend of Zelda II only a lot more enjoyable.

Wonderboy III Dragon's Trap is a very hard game but really really enjoyable.

Wonderboy In Monster World for the Genesis/MegaDrive isn't as hard and actually is fairly balanced in terms of difficulty.

Wonderboy with the Girl I haven't played much of it though. Sort of got bored early on as it just had a very different feel to the game.

Part of the reason that boss in Wonder Boy in Monster World US/EU is so hard is because the difficulty for it was altered for the US. I have played through the Dynastic Hero version of the game and that version of the boss (based on the original JP difficulty) wasn't too hard to beat.
